AGENCY: Homeless Children’s Network

TITLE: Contracts Coordinator

SCHEDULE: Full-time position, 40 hours per week

BENEFITS: Health, Dental, and Vision insurance; Generous PTO; Commuter stipend

SALARY: $70,000



ABOUT HOMELESS CHILDREN’S NETWORK

The mission of Homeless Children’s Network is to decrease the trauma of homelessness and domestic violence for children, youth, and families; to empower families; and to increase the effectiveness of collaborative efforts among service providers to end homelessness and poverty.


Job Description:

Major responsibilities will include:

● Support the successful and meticulous execution of all city, county and privately funded contracts, as well as the timely submission of budget modifications throughout the fiscal year.

● Manage and monitor all invoicing against contracts, including the tracking of YTD invoices vs. budgets, any and all template modifications and supplemental awards

● Oversee the subcontracting process for the organization's subcontractors, ensuring the timely completion of MOUs and budgets associated with multiple large grants and contracts.

● Develop and improve an internal and external communications process to ensure the timely submission of financial and deliverables reports for reimbursement and successful execution of grant and contract requirements.

● Working closely with the internal QA team, develop and improve internal data management systems for outcomes tracking and monitoring.

● Serve as the internal and external expert for the organization's grants and contracts management system for awards.

● Support program management and staff to draft deliverables and reports for contracts and grants as needed and to ensure timely and accurate submissions.

● Work closely with Development, Finance, and Program staff to develop contract/proposal budgets.

● Coordinate with Finance and Program staff to ensure contract/grant funds are properly allocated to program initiatives while ensuring no budgeted salary or expense is over-funded.

● Oversee the timely close-out, renewal, or extension for all the organization's contracts and grants.

● Oversee all aspects of government contract audits, site visits and monitoring visits, preparing requested documentation ahead of time and serving as a point person for all communications.


Qualifications:

● Bachelor’s degree required

● A minimum of 3 years of relevant experience with grants or contracts administration, including the management of financial reports

● Experience with State and City contracts

● An understanding of financial principles and basic QuickBooks knowledge

● Strong financial management and analytical skills, with experience developing and monitoring budgets and financial reporting

● Highly detail-oriented, with demonstrated ability to accurately track multiple grants and contracts concurrently

● Supervisory experience a plus

● Excellent written and verbal communication skills

● Exceptional organizational skills, with demonstrated ability to manage concurrent multiple assignments, meet tight deadlines, and prioritize accordingly

● Superior relationship management skills, with ability to work both independently and collaboratively
